Start Free Trial / Test Salesforce →Environmental Testing Laboratories operate in a high-stakes, heavily regulated industry governed by strict EPA guidelines, ISO/IEC 17025 accreditation standards, and complex Chain of Custody (CoC) requirements. Managing client relationships, field sampling operations, contract renewal cycles, and large volume testing SLAs requires an enterprise-grade infrastructure.
While core sample analysis is managed inside a Laboratory Information Management System (LIMS), Salesforce serves as the central commercial engine, bridging the gap between business operations, client communication, and technical data pipelines.
Why Salesforce Fits Environmental Testing Laboratories
Commercial environmental testing facilities—handling soil, water, air, and hazardous waste analysis—deal with complex B2B sales cycles involving engineering firms, industrial facilities, and government entities. Salesforce provides the robust architecture necessary to support these workflows:
- LIMS & Field Data Integration: Through robust REST/SOAP APIs and middleware like MuleSoft, Salesforce integrates bi-directionally with LIMS platforms (e.g., LabWare, Thermo Fisher SampleManager). This allows sales and account managers to track sample intake status, testing backlogs, and automated delivery of Certificates of Analysis (CoA) without logging into technical lab environments.
- Chain of Custody (CoC) & Logistics Orchestration: Salesforce can be configured to manage pre-log-in logistics, tracking cooler dispatches, field sampling schedules, and sample bottle kit requests prior to formal LIMS accessioning.
- Regulatory Audit Trails & SLA Tracking: Salesforce’s native auditing tools track every interaction, contract modification, and pricing change—vital for laboratories operating under strict QA/QC regulatory standards and ISO compliance checks.
- Enterprise Account Management: Environmental labs often handle multi-site industrial accounts requiring complex parent-child hierarchy mapping, customized tier pricing, and automated compliance alert workflows.
Technical Feature Breakdown & System Specifications
Key Technical Capabilities
- Advanced Customization (Data Architecture & Logic):
- Custom Objects and relationships allow labs to model specialized entities like “Sampling Sites,” “Matrix Types,” “Permit Limits,” and “Test Packages.”
- Custom Apex code and Lightning Web Components (LWC) enable tailored user interfaces for complex environmental quote generation based on parameters, turn-around times (TAT), and hold times.
- AI Analytics (Salesforce Einstein):
- Predictive churn modeling for recurring industrial monitoring accounts.
- Predictive workload forecasting to help lab directors align staffing levels with incoming sample volumes based on pipeline win rates.
- Automated insight extraction from complex B2B contract terms and regulatory bidding documents.
- Omnichannel Routing:
- Intelligent, skill-based routing for client services, directing incoming inquiries regarding hold times, sample preservation, or CoA status to the correct subject matter experts (e.g., Organic Chemistry, Inorganics, or Microbiology departments).
- Automated case creation and dispatch across email, web portals, phone, and API endpoints.

Platform Advantages (Pros)
- Highly Scalable Architecture: Designed to handle millions of record transactions seamlessly, accommodating high-volume testing labs managing thousands of distinct sampling points and matrix variations daily.
- Massive App Ecosystem (AppExchange): Direct access to pre-built connectors for ERP systems, contract management tools (e.g., DocuSign, Conga), and field services management tools tailored for environmental field teams.
- Extensible Middleware Support: Native compatibility with enterprise integration platforms simplifies connectivity with legacy LIMS, ELNs (Electronic Lab Notebooks), and environmental compliance databases.
Key Limitations & Operational Considerations (Cons)
- Steep Learning Curve: The depth of the platform requires specialized Salesforce Administrators and Developers, particularly when configuring complex triggers, LWC interfaces, and API integrations with legacy LIMS architectures.
- Expensive Add-ons & Storage: Advanced capabilities like Einstein AI, Field Service Lightning (for field sampling crews), MuleSoft integration, and additional data storage (frequently impacted by high-volume logging) can significantly increase total cost of ownership (TCO).
